Betting Mechanics and Payout Structures

Standard blackjack rules apply, but subtle differences shift the house edge:

  • Dealer hits soft 17 (common).
  • Double after split allowed on many tables.
  • Surrender sometimes available.
  • Insurance pays 2:1 but isn’t profitable long term.

Payouts normally go 1:1 for wins, 3:2 for naturals. Variants like Blackjack Switch can pay 8:5 on certain hands, raising potential returns.
